All complex organisms are made up of a variety of different types of cells, eg nerve cells, muscle cells, blood cells., These specialised cells all differentiate from one type of cell called a stem cell., Stem cells are undifferentiated cells that can give rise to many more cells of the same type., There are two main types of stem cell, embryonic and adult., Embryonic stem cells can differentiate into any type of cell. Adult stem cells can only differentiate into certain cells, eg bone marrow stem cells can only give rise to blood cells., Stem cells can be cloned to produce millions of the same type of cell. These can be used to replace damaged cells and treat conditions like Alzheimer's and paralysis,
